What I Looked for in Build Quality
My first priority was build quality. I checked whether the plastic felt thick and sturdy, because I did not want a box that would crack under pressure. I also paid attention to the wheels, handle, and latches. In my experience, a rolling tool box is only as good as its weakest part, so I made sure these components looked solid and well-attached.
Size and Storage Capacity
I found that choosing the right size depends on how many tools I use regularly. If I only need to store hand tools, a compact model works well for me. But when I want to carry drills, chargers, screwdrivers, and accessories, I prefer a larger box with multiple compartments. I always think about whether I need deep storage, removable trays, or stackable sections before I buy.
Mobility and Wheel Performance
Since the box is meant to roll, I always test or review the wheel quality. I prefer wheels that move smoothly on concrete, garage floors, and uneven surfaces. In my experience, larger wheels are easier to handle when I need to move the box over small obstacles. A comfortable telescoping handle also makes a big difference when I’m pulling the box for longer distances.
Organization Features I Prefer
I like a tool box that helps me stay organized instead of turning into one big storage bin. That is why I look for trays, dividers, removable organizers, and separate compartments. When I can quickly find screws, bits, pliers, or tape, I save time and avoid frustration. Good organization features make the box much more practical for my daily work.
Durability and Weather Resistance
Because I sometimes use my tools in garages, outdoor spaces, and work areas, I want a box that can resist dust and moisture. I check whether the lid closes tightly and whether the material can handle regular exposure to rough conditions. A plastic rolling tool box with decent weather resistance gives me more confidence that my tools will stay protected.
Weight and Portability
One of the reasons I prefer plastic is that it is lighter than many metal storage options. Even when loaded with tools, I find it easier to manage if the box itself does not add too much extra weight. If I need to lift it into a vehicle or move it up steps, portability becomes very important to me.
Locking and Security Options
Security matters to me, especially if I leave tools in a shared garage or worksite. I look for boxes with latch systems that close firmly and, if possible, lock compatibility. While not every plastic rolling tool box offers advanced security, I still want enough protection to keep the lid shut and discourage easy access.
